Mental Health Services in Little Rock, Arkansas

With a population of over 197,000, Little Rock, Arkansas is a vibrant city known for its southern hospitality, rich history, and cultural diversity. The city's picturesque landscape is marked by the sparkling Arkansas River and the iconic Pinnacle Mountain nearby.

Key Mental-Health Concerns for Little Rock Residents

In Little Rock, depression and anxiety are common mental health concerns. According to the CDC, Arkansas has a higher prevalence of mental health conditions than the national average. Additionally, the NIMH reports that substance use disorders are a significant issue in the state.

Access to Care & Providers in Little Rock

Accessing mental health treatment in Little Rock, Arkansas is facilitated by both public and private providers. There are numerous crisis lines, community organizations, and innovative local initiatives such as the BridgeWay Hospital and the Recovery Centers of Arkansas.

Therapies & Specialties

  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) are widely available in Little Rock.
  • Many providers offer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) and trauma-focused care.
  • Unique local offerings include e-therapy, bilingual care, and dedicated support for veterans.

Local Policies & Stressors

Little Rock, Arkansas grapples with a variety of local stressors. The cost of living is relatively low, but many residents face pressures from industry changes, remote-work trends, and occasional severe weather.
